Kitchen Island
A freestanding cabinet unit in the middle of the kitchen, often with seating, additional storage, sink, or cooktop.

Why it matters
Islands are the #1 requested kitchen feature, but require minimum 36–42" walkways on all sides — they don't fit every layout.
Typical cost
$3,000–$15,000 depending on size, plumbing, and electrical.

Frequently asked questions
- How big should a kitchen island be?
- Minimum 4×2 ft with 36"+ walkways; ideal is 6–8 ft long if your space allows.
